ISC2 Cloud Security Certificates (CSC)
Overview
The ISC2 Cloud Security Certificates (CSC) are designed to help cybersecurity professionals advance their skills in cloud security. These certificates provide a pathway to the CCSP certification and demonstrate a commitment to maintaining ISC2 certifications through professional development.
The CSC validates an individual’s ability to:
- Understand cloud computing concepts and architecture.
- Apply security principles to cloud environments.
- Implement secure cloud migration strategies.
Course Details
The CSC bundle consists of three certificates:
- Cloud Basics Certificate: Covers foundational cloud computing concepts, including drivers for cloud adoption, cloud architecture, and service models.
- Moving to the Cloud Certificate: Focuses on the strategic and secure approach to cloud migration using a four-phased process.
- Working in the Cloud Certificate: Immerses learners in real-world cloud security challenges from the perspective of a cloud security professional.

Exam Structure
To earn each CSC, candidates must score 70% or higher on the final assessment. The assessments can be taken directly if the learner already possesses the required knowledge.
Key Exam Requirements:
- Passing score of 70% or higher on the final assessment.
- Completion of the learning and assessment or assessment only option.
